There are plenty of synonyms for the term "reduced fat" that can be used to describe foods that are lower in fat content. These include terms like "low-fat", "fat-free", "light", "skim", "lean", "reduced-calorie", and "healthier". All of these terms are used to indicate that a product contains less fat and fewer calories than its regular counterpart. Many health-conscious consumers seek out products with these descriptors on labels, as they are often trying to manage their cholesterol levels, lose weight, or simply maintain a healthier lifestyle. Choosing foods with these phrases on their packaging can help individuals reach their health goals and make more informed dietary choices.
